Is Mount Rushmore part of the Rockies?

No, Mount Rushmore is not part of the Rocky Mountains. It is located in the Black Hills region of South Dakota, which is a distinct mountain range separate from the Rockies. The Black Hills are known for their unique geological features and historical significance, including the famous granite face of Mount Rushmore itself.
